How to fill out bits and pieces newsletter

How to fill out Bits and Pieces newsletter:
01
Start by gathering relevant content: Look for interesting news articles, educational resources, or entertaining stories that you believe would be of interest to your subscribers. Ensure that the content you select aligns with the theme or purpose of your newsletter.
02
Create engaging headings and summaries: Once you have selected the content, write eye-catching headings and concise summaries for each article. These should give your readers a brief overview of what to expect and entice them to read further.
03
Include visuals: To make your newsletter visually appealing, consider incorporating relevant images or graphics alongside the content. Visuals can help grab the attention of your readers and make the newsletter more enjoyable to browse through.
04
Add personal touches: Consider adding a personal note or introduction at the beginning of the newsletter. This can help establish a connection with your readers and make the content feel more relatable.
05
Format and organize: Pay attention to the overall layout and design of your newsletter. Use appropriate fonts, colors, and spacing to make it visually appealing and easy to read. Organize the content in a logical order, placing the most important or engaging articles at the top.
06
Proofread and edit: Before sending the newsletter, proofread it carefully to eliminate any grammatical or spelling errors. Ensure that all links are working correctly and that the overall flow of the newsletter is smooth and coherent.
